Understanding the Technology Behind Online Casinos

The backbone of any online casino is its software platform. These platforms are typically powered by leading software developers such as NetEnt, Microgaming, and Playtech, who create the games themselves and provide the infrastructure on which the casino operates. The quality of the software directly impacts the player experience, influencing factors like graphics, sound effects, and overall gameplay smoothness. Modern online casinos increasingly utilize HTML5 technology, enabling users to play games directly in their web browsers without the need for downloads. This browser-based approach offers greater flexibility and compatibility across various devices.

A critical component of online casino technology is the Random Number Generator (RNG). The RNG ensures that each game outcome is completely random and unbiased, preventing manipulation and guaranteeing fair play. Independent auditing firms regularly test RNGs to verify their integrity. Beyond the RNG, secure servers and encryption protocols are vital for protecting player data and financial transactions. Secure Socket Layer (SSL) encryption is a standard practice, safeguarding sensitive information as it travels between the player's device and the casino's servers. The ongoing development of blockchain technology is also beginning to introduce new levels of transparency and security to the online gambling industry.

The Role of Live Dealer Games

Live dealer games represent a significant evolution in online casino entertainment. These games stream real-time footage of a human dealer, recreating the atmosphere of a traditional brick-and-mortar casino. Players can interact with the dealer via chat, adding a social element to the experience. Popular live dealer games include blackjack, roulette, baccarat, and poker. The technology behind live dealer games is complex, requiring high-quality video streaming, reliable internet connections, and sophisticated software to manage the gameplay and betting process. Live games often have higher betting limits than standard online casino games, catering to experienced players seeking a more immersive experience.

The rise of live dealer games has fundamentally changed the landscape of online gambling, bridging the gap between the convenience of online access and the authenticity of a land-based casino. They offer a level of trust and transparency that some players find reassuring, as they can visually confirm the fairness of the game.

The Importance of Licensing and Regulation

Operating an online casino legally requires obtaining a license from a reputable regulatory body. These bodies, such as the Malta Gaming Authority, the UK Gambling Commission, and the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ority, impose strict standards on casinos to ensure fair play, player protection, and responsible gambling practices. Licensing requirements include thorough background checks of the casino operator, regular audits of the software and RNG, and adherence to anti-money laundering regulations. Obtaining and maintaining a license is a rigorous process, demonstrating a commitment to ethical and transparent operations. Players should always verify that an online casino holds a valid license before depositing any funds.

Regulation extends beyond licensing to encompass responsible gambling initiatives. Casinos are increasingly implementing measures to help players manage their gambling habits, such as deposit limits, loss limits, self-exclusion programs, and access to problem gambling resources. These tools empower players to stay in control of their spending and prevent potential harm. Reputable regulatory bodies also investigate player complaints and mediate disputes between players and casinos.

Understanding Different Licensing Jurisdictions

Different licensing jurisdictions have varying levels of stringency and reputation. The UK Gambling Commission is considered one of the most respected and demanding regulatory bodies, requiring casinos to meet extremely high standards. The Malta Gaming Authority is also highly regarded, offering a robust regulatory framework. Other jurisdictions, such as Curacao, may have less stringent requirements, which can potentially raise concerns about player protection. Players should research the licensing jurisdiction of an online casino and consider its reputation before playing. Understanding the regulatory environment provides a critical layer of security and assurance.

The location of a casino’s licensing also impacts tax implications and legal recourse in the event of disputes. Casinos licensed in reputable jurisdictions are generally more accountable and responsive to player concerns.

Payment Methods and Security

A wide range of payment methods are typically offered at online casinos, including credit and debit cards, e-wallets (such as P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ller), bank transfers, and increasingly, cryptocurrencies. The availability of convenient and secure payment options is crucial for attracting and retaining players. E-wallets offer an added layer of security, as they act as intermediaries between the player's bank account and the casino. C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in and Ethereum, are gaining popularity due to their anonymity and fast transaction times.

Security is paramount when it comes to online payments. Casinos employ various security measures to protect player financial information, including SSL encryption, firewalls, and fraud prevention systems. Payment processors also have their own security protocols in place. Players should be wary of casinos that require them to share sensitive information, such as credit card PINs or social security numbers. It’s also vital to use strong, unique passwords and enable two-factor authentication whenever possible.

Withdrawal Processes and Potential Delays

The withdrawal process at online casinos can sometimes be a source of frustration for players. Casinos typically require players to verify their identity before processing a withdrawal, which may involve submitting documents such as proof of address and a copy of their government-issued ID. This verification process is intended to prevent fraud and money laundering. Withdrawal times can vary depending on the payment method used and the casino's internal processing procedures. E-wallets generally offer the fastest withdrawal times, while bank transfers can take several business days. Players should carefully review the casino's withdrawal policy before depositing any funds.

Understanding the conditions surrounding withdrawals, including potential fees and processing times, is critical for ensuring a smooth and transparent gaming experience.
